    Food: - Peking Pork Chops: The pork chop was cut into pieces and cooked in Peking sauce. The meat was tender and had amazing flavor. I wish the pieces were cut even smaller. The knife they gave me didn't cut through the meat easily. 4.5/5 - Mongolian Beef: The beef was cooked with green bell peppers, white onions, and green onions. It was very tasty. I would of liked it more if it was spicier. The meat was tender enough for me to eat (I'm picky when it comes to the consistency of beef). 4/5. - Tempura Bananas with Vanilla Ice Cream: This was sooooo good! The fried bananas was served with whipped cream, drizzled with chocolate syrup and condensed milk. 5/5 Service: Our waitresses were not friendly, but not rude. The lady who took care of our bill was upset that we wanted to pay individually. 3/5 Final Thoughts: I would definitely come back. Everything I've tried here has been delicious!

    We placed a large takeout order from Tayzan after seeing the long line outside and all the great…read morereviews. Since it was just a short walk from our hotel, we decided to give it a try. My parents had eaten here before and said it was really good, so we were excited to see if it lived up to the hype. The restaurant had a lively, bustling atmosphere, with a steady stream of customers dining in and picking up takeout orders. Even though it was busy, the staff kept things moving efficiently. Even for a large order, the wait was only about 30 minutes. They have a separate pickup area for to-go orders, which made the process organized and easy despite how busy they were. We ordered the beef fried rice, house fried rice, churrasco steak, house lo mein, sesame beef, jumbo shrimp, chicken wings, fried pork, pork ramen, and three sushi rolls. The kids in our family chose the Philly Roll, Salmon Avocado Roll, and Red Dragon Roll, and they really enjoyed them. I had originally planned to order a different sushi roll from the menu, but it wasn't available that day. It wasn't a big deal, though, because the rolls we did get were fresh and delicious. Everything was flavorful and well prepared. The churrasco steak was my personal favorite--the meat was incredibly tender and already well seasoned on its own. My husband wasn't a fan of the accompanying sauce, but he agreed the steak itself was excellent. We also really enjoyed the fried rice, and the portions were generous. They were also generous with the condiments and included a variety of sauces with our order, which we appreciated. The only thing we missed was chili oil, since it's a condiment we usually expect to have available at Chinese restaurants. If you're staying nearby or looking for a restaurant that offers both Chinese and Japanese cuisine, Tayzan is definitely worth checking out. Just be prepared for a crowd--it seems to be popular for a reason!
